Embedded Firmware Engineer

4 days ago


Mumbai, Maharashtra, India 5a8d4603-ba74-41cf-bf35-548dd80de294 Full time ₹ 12,00,000 - ₹ 36,00,000 per year

We are seeking a highly skilled Embedded Linux Engineer with deep experience in Yocto Project BSP developmentfor ARM-based platforms.

You will be responsible for building and maintaining custom Linux distributions, device drivers, and system components that power our intelligent embedded devices.

Key Responsibilities

  • Develop and maintain Yocto-based BSP layers for ARM and NXP platforms.
  • Configure and integrate Linux kernel, device tree, and drivers for custom hardware.
  • Design, implement, and debug Linux device drivers and board bring-up code.
  • Collaborate with cross-functional teams to ensure seamless hardware-software integration.
  • Optimize bootloaders, kernel performance, and system startup.
  • Maintain build automation, version control (Git), and CI/CD processes for embedded systems.
  • Document design decisions, system configurations, and release notes.

Requirements

  • Minimum 5 years of hands-on experience with Yocto Project and Embedded Linux development.
  • Strong command of C programming and solid understanding of embedded system design.
  • Good proficiency in Python for scripting, build automation, or testing.
  • Practical experience with Linux kernel, device tree configuration, and driver development.
  • Familiarity with ARM-based architectures (preferably NXP i.MX series).
  • Comfortable with Git, shell scripting, and cross-compilation toolchains.
  • Strong problem-solving and debugging skills using tools like JTAG, UART, or logic analyzers.
  • Excellent written and spoken English communication skills.

Nice to Have

  • Hands-on experience with U-Boot, systemd, and bootloader customization.
  • Experience with wireless interfaces, SPI/IC/UART, or Ethernet drivers.
  • Familiarity with containerized build environments or CI pipelines.
  • Exposure to RTOS, Bare Metal, or industrial communication protocols.

What We Offer

  • 100% remote work flexibility.
  • Opportunity to work with innovative embedded technologies.
  • Collaborative engineering culture focused on technical excellence and continuous learning.
  • Competitive compensation and growth within an advanced R&D environment.


  • Mumbai, Maharashtra, India IZI Full time ₹ 6,00,000 - ₹ 18,00,000 per year

    Position Title: Embedded Firmware EngineerYears of Experience: 3+ yearsWork Model: Work From OfficeLocation: Bhopal, Madhya PradeshAbout Us:At IZI, we are revolutionizing the world of consumer drones with cutting-edge technology, innovative design, and a passion for excellence. we're on a mission to shake up the Indian tech scene by becoming the ultimate...

  • - Engineering Manager

    2 weeks ago


    Mumbai, Maharashtra, India RN CHIDAKASHI TECHNOLOGIES PRIVATE LIMITED Full time ₹ 12,00,000 - ₹ 24,00,000 per year

    Position Overview : We are seeking an experienced Engineering Manager to lead our embedded firmware development team. This role combines hands-on technical expertise with people management responsibilities, focusing on driving day-to-day operations, team development, and project execution in a. fast-paced embedded systems environment.Key...


  • Mumbai, Maharashtra, India Capgemini Full time ₹ 9,00,000 - ₹ 12,00,000 per year

    About The Role - Grade Specific  Embedded Firmware Tester   Location:-  Mumbai Experience:-  6 to 9 Years Your Role   - Embedded Systems Knowledge Understanding microcontrollers, sensors, and hardware interfaces like SPI, I2C, UART. - Programming Languages Basics knowledge of C or C++ - RTOS & Embedded Linux Experience with Real-Time...


  • Mumbai, Maharashtra, India aa-463c-49a5-956b-a714eaaa10c2 Full time ₹ 12,00,000 - ₹ 24,00,000 per year

    Job DescriptionLead the complete development lifecycle of embedded products from concept to manufacturing, ensuring seamless integration of hardware and firmware componentsWrite code and develop firmware from scratch as necessary to meet project requirements, ensuring optimal performance and functionalityCollaborate with electrical and mechanical engineers...


  • Mumbai, Maharashtra, India Qode Full time ₹ 20,00,000 - ₹ 25,00,000 per year

    We are seeking a highly experienced Firmware Engineer with 8+ years of hands-on experience inembedded audio software development, including Bluetooth audio, low-power design, andaudio signal processing. This is a critical role in our hardware-software co-development team,where your expertise will directly impact the performance and user experience of our...


  • Navi Mumbai, Maharashtra, India edde5f00-c98d-437d-a314-0570a462c245 Full time ₹ 5,00,000 - ₹ 15,00,000 per year

    Company DescriptionEmbedCrest Technology Pvt. Ltd. is a specialized consulting and development firm providing high-reliability embedded software solutions to the IoT, Automotive, and Industrial sectors. With expertise in AI-driven firmware development, the company transforms innovative ideas into high-performance products. Their key offerings include...


  • Mumbai, Maharashtra, India Qode Full time ₹ 12,00,000 - ₹ 36,00,000 per year

    We are seeking a highly experienced Firmware Engineer with 8+ years of hands-on experience in embedded audio software development, including Bluetooth audio, low-power design, and audio signal processing. This is a critical role in our hardware-software co-development team, where your expertise will directly impact the performance and user experience of our...


  • Navi Mumbai, Maharashtra, India Appzime Technologies Full time ₹ 8,00,000 - ₹ 25,00,000 per year

    Experienced Firmware Engineer with 8+ years of hands-on experience inembedded audio software development, including Bluetooth audio, low-power design, andaudio signal processing.


  • Mumbai, Maharashtra, India The Value Maximizer Full time ₹ 20,00,000 - ₹ 25,00,000 per year

    We are seeking a highly experienced Firmware Engineer with 8+ years of hands-on experience inembedded audio software development, including Bluetooth audio, low-power design, andaudio signal processing. This is a critical role in our hardware-software co-development team,where your expertise will directly impact the performance and user experience of our...


  • Mumbai, Maharashtra, India Schneider Electric Full time ₹ 6,00,000 - ₹ 18,00,000 per year

    Job Description:Lauritz Knudsen Electrical and Automation is a pioneering electrical and automation brand with a rich legacy of over 70 years in India. We offer comprehensive portfolio of low-voltage switchgear, medium-voltage switchgear, automation solutions, software, and services catering to diverse segments, including homes, agriculture, buildings,...